Preparation

Preparing the Bacon

1. Cook the Bacon

Preheat a large skillet over medium heat. Once hot, add the thick sliced applewood smoked bacon to the skillet in a single layer. Cook for about 4-5 minutes on each side or until it reaches your desired crispiness.

2. Drain Excess Fat

Once the bacon is cooked, remove it from the skillet and place it on a plate lined with paper towels to absorb any excess grease.

Preparing the Fresh Fruit

3. Wash the Fruit

Rinse the strawberries and blueberries under cold water. Pat them dry with a clean kitchen towel.

4. Prepare the Honeydew and Pineapple

Cut the honeydew melon and pineapple into bite-sized pieces.

5. Combine the Fruit

In a large bowl, combine the strawberries, blueberries, honeydew melon, and pineapple. Gently toss the fruit together.

6. Garnish with Mint

Chop the mint leaves finely and sprinkle them over the fruit mixture. Toss gently to incorporate.

Serving

7. Plate the Dish

On a serving platter, arrange the crispy bacon slices alongside the fresh fruit mixture. Serve immediately for the best flavor.
